2025-05-20 15:22:44
64

微信小程序部署阿里云服务器全攻略

摘要
在互联网快速发展的今天,微信小程序因其便捷性与易用性受到越来越多开发者的青睐。对于新手而言,如何将微信小程序部署到阿里云服务器上可能是个难题。本文旨在提供一份详细的指南,帮助您顺利完成这一过程。 一、准备工作 您需要拥有一个已注册并实名认证的阿里云账号。接着,根据您的项目需求选择合适的服务器配置,并完成购买流程。请确保…...

在互联网快速发展的今天,微信小程序因其便捷性与易用性受到越来越多开发者的青睐。对于新手而言,如何将微信小程序部署到阿里云服务器上可能是个难题。本文旨在提供一份详细的指南,帮助您顺利完成这一过程。

一、准备工作

您需要拥有一个已注册并实名认证的阿里云账号。接着,根据您的项目需求选择合适的服务器配置,并完成购买流程。请确保您的计算机已经安装了必要的软件环境,例如Node.js(用于运行后端代码)、Git(版本控制工具)等。

二、创建ECS实例

登录阿里云官网,在控制台中找到“ECS”服务,点击“立即购买”。按照提示设置地域与可用区、实例规格、镜像市场(建议选择官方提供的Ubuntu系统),以及网络类型等信息后提交订单。

三、配置安全组规则

为了保证服务器的安全性,我们需要为新创建的ECS实例添加适当的安全组规则。进入相应实例详情页面,在左侧菜单栏中选择“本实例安全组”,然后点击“添加安全组规则”。一般情况下,开放80端口(HTTP服务)和443端口(HTTPS服务)即可满足基本需求。

四、连接远程服务器

使用SSH客户端(如PuTTY)或者命令行工具连接至您的阿里云ECS实例。首次登录时需输入用户名及密码/密钥对进行验证。

五、安装Nginx作为Web服务器

通过执行以下命令来安装Nginx:

sudo apt update
sudo apt install nginx -y

之后可以通过浏览器访问您的公网IP地址查看Nginx欢迎页面,以确认安装成功。

六、上传微信小程序后端代码

如果您使用的是基于Node.js搭建的小程序后端,则可以利用npm或其他包管理器安装所需依赖库。随后,将源码文件通过FTP/SFTP等方式上传至服务器指定目录下。

七、配置域名解析

为了让用户能够通过自定义域名而非直接IP地址访问您的小程序,还需要在阿里云平台上添加相应的域名解析记录。这一步骤通常涉及添加A记录指向您的ECS实例IP地址。

八、SSL证书申请与配置

为了提高数据传输的安全性,建议为您的网站启用HTTPS协议。阿里云提供了免费的SSL证书服务,只需按照指引完成申请流程,并将其正确配置到Nginx服务器中即可。

九、测试上线

至此,所有准备工作均已就绪。最后别忘了在微信公众平台开发者工具中修改API请求地址为你服务器的实际域名,并进行充分的功能测试,确保一切正常后再正式对外发布。

以上就是关于如何将微信小程序部署到阿里云服务器上的完整教程。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部